Daniels Wood Land (DWL) is a custom design and fabrication company for offline entertainment and experiential spaces. Its services cover themed environments, treehouses, themed playgrounds, electronic shooting galleries, wood carving, props, artificial trees, rockwork, animatronics, and interactive attractions. Its client scenarios include theme parks, museums, science centers, zoos, aquariums, family entertainment centers, resorts, restaurant and retail activations, and private residential projects.
DWL’s value lies not in a single design concept, but in a complete delivery chain from concept to installation. The site describes a process that includes concept design, design development, engineering coordination, construction documentation, scheduling, budgeting, project management, fabrication, installation, and final commissioning. Its fabrication capabilities cover wood, steel, foam, fiberglass/concrete, 3D printing, CNC/foam milling, sculpting, scenic painting, lighting, audio, animatronics, and show-control technology. InterACT is one of its more distinctive interactive systems, supporting RFID/token souvenir triggers and integration with lighting, audio, animatronics, video, special effects, DMX, and external controllers. It can be used for free-form interactions, limited-use interactions, and treasure-hunt-style multi-station experiences.
The website does not publish standard pricing or price ranges, so it is clearly based on project-by-project quotations. The pages mention budget/cost proposals, and shooting galleries can be customized by theme, space, and budget. InterACT can also scale from a single interactive point to an entire venue. For shooting galleries, the site lists options ranging from compact 2-gun systems to larger 6–8 gun and 12–16 gun setups, and offers a 1-year limited warranty, free technical support, and lifetime software upgrades.
The advantages are its complete capability chain: it can handle creative themed environments as well as durable facilities for public operations, while also emphasizing ASTM and ADA compliance for playgrounds. InterACT also connects souvenirs, interactive stations, and venue circulation, which can help extend dwell time and encourage repeat visits. The downside is limited information transparency: pricing, timelines, payment methods, international implementation requirements, and specific customer case data are not fully disclosed. For Chinese clients, shipping, on-site installation, local safety regulations, and after-sales response all need additional confirmation.
DWL is better suited to cultural tourism, theme park, museum, FEC, resort hotel, and branded experience projects with physical-space budgets that require deep customization and long-term operation. It is not suitable for teams that only need flat visual design, online assets, or lightweight software tools.
